Eight of family killed in Jaipur as tanker truck overturns on car

Follow Us :
Text Size:

Jaipur, May 4 (PTI) Eight members of an extended family, including three children, were killed here on Thursday after a tanker truck overturned on the car they were travelling in, police said.

The accident took place on the Jaipur-Ajmer highway near Ramnagar area at around 12.30 pm, they said.

The car occupants were on their way to Ajmer from Phagi town to offer prayers at the Ajmer Dargah, police said.

Jaipur SP (Rural) Rajeev Pachar said the truck fully loaded with thermal plant ash was going from Ajmer towards Jaipur. Due to the bursting of the front tyre near Ramnagar in Dudu area, the truck became uncontrollable, jumped the divider and overturned on the car coming from the front.

He said a forensic team from Jaipur has also reached the spot to collect the tyres of the truck and other evidence from the spot to find out what exactly led to the accident.

The car had nine occupants when the truck overturned on it.

While seven people died on the spot, one other succumbed to injuries on the way to a hospital, Assistant Sub-Inspector (Dudu) Rajendra Prasad said.

The deceased have been identified as Israil (45), his wife Harjana (27), their daughter Rohina (8), son Shahran (3), Murad (13), Shakeel (30), Sonu (18), Haseena (45).

The car passengers were on their way to Ajmer from Phagi for a pilgrimage, the ASI said. He said that after the post-mortem, the bodies were handed over to the relatives.

A case against the tanker driver has been registered and the matter is being investigated, police said.
